## Summary
The channels-ws-batch E2E tests had a race condition causing flaky
failures on CI, blocking PRs #1490, #1500, #1501.
**Root cause:** Tests waited on `messages.length === prev + 1`, but live
WS traffic from the ingestor could bump `length` independently, causing
timeouts. The earlier #1499 fix attempted to find messages by
`m.hash`/`m.id`, but `processWSBatch` stores `packetHash`/`packetId` on
message objects — so the find never matched.
**Fix:** Replace all length-based waiters with `messages.some(m =>
m.packetHash === '<known-hash>')` which is deterministic regardless of
concurrent WS traffic. Also un-skips the explicit-sender test that was
force-skipped in #1502.

# fix(1506): restore marker-stroke server defaults to v3.7.2 visual
Closes#1506. Refs #1494, #1488.
## Why
PR #1494 introduced operator-tunable marker stroke via
`--mc-marker-stroke-*` CSS vars but chose new server defaults
(translucent white, 1px) that look weak next to the v3.7.2 baseline
(solid white, 2px). Operators upgrading from v3.7.x see a visible
regression on the map.
## What
Restore the v3.7.2 visual as the server default. Customizer + config
plumbing are unchanged — anyone who preferred the thinner translucent
style can dial it back via the in-app customizer (Colors → Marker
Stroke).
| File | Before | After |
|---|---|---|
| `public/style.css` `:root` | `rgba(255,255,255,0.85)` / `1` / `1` |
`#fff` / `2` / `1` |
| `public/customize-v2.js` `msWidth` fallback | `1` | `2` |
| `config.example.json` `markerStroke.color/width` | `rgba(...,0.85)` /
`1` | `#fff` / `2` |
Customizer overrides already in localStorage continue to take effect —
only the unset baseline shifts.

## Summary
The version/commit badge currently rendered in the nav stats bar
(alongside packet counts, node counts, and observer counts) is
operator-facing diagnostic information — not something end users need
visible on every page load. For most visitors, it adds visual noise
without adding value.
## Changes
- **perf.js**: Add a **Version** card to the Perf dashboard overview
row. Shows `version` + short `commit` hash, both already available from
`/api/health` (no new API surface needed). Card renders conditionally —
if neither field is set it stays hidden.
- **app.js**: Remove `formatVersionBadge()` and `formatEngineBadge()`
helper functions (now unused); strip the badge call from
`updateNavStats()` so the navbar shows only packet/node/observer counts.
- **style.css**: Remove now-dead `.nav-stats .version-badge`,
`.nav-stats .engine-badge`, and their link sub-rules.
## Rationale
The Perf page is explicitly the right place for this information — it's
already scoped to operators and developers who want to know what version
is running. The navbar is a high-visibility surface shared by all users;
version strings belong in a diagnostic context, not a navigation bar.
Net result: navbar is cleaner for end users; operators can still find
version info immediately on the Perf tab.
## Summary
`🗑️ Reset All Customizations` only stripped `cs-theme-overrides`,
leaving CB-preset, encrypted-channel toggle, dark-tile pick,
marker-stroke vars and the per-role `--mc-role-*` body.style writes from
PRs #1361/#1430/#1448/#1454/#1488 stuck. Operators had to clear
localStorage by hand to actually reset.
Single source of truth lands as `_resetAll()` in
`public/customize-v2.js` (exposed on `_customizerV2.resetAll` for
tests). The Reset button delegates to it. Future customizer features
extend ONE function — not 12 scattered call-sites.
## What is cleared
| surface | keys / props |
|---|---|
| localStorage | `cs-theme-overrides`, `meshcore-cb-preset`,
`channels-show-encrypted`, `mc-dark-tile-provider` |
| body attr | `data-cb-preset` |
| body.style | `--mc-role-{role}`, `--mc-role-{role}-text` for
repeater/companion/room/sensor/observer |
| :root style | `--mc-role-*`, `--mc-role-*-text`, `--node-*`,
`--mc-marker-stroke-{color,width,opacity}`,
`--mc-mb-{confirmed,suspected,unknown}`, `--mc-rt-ramp-{0..4}`,
`--logo-accent`, `--logo-accent-hi`, every value in `THEME_CSS_MAP` |
CB-preset teardown delegates to `MeshCorePresets.clearPreset()` so
`cb-preset-changed` fires and downstream consumers re-sync to server
config without a reload. Tile-provider teardown re-applies the active id
(which now falls through to server default / `carto-dark`) so
`mc-tile-provider-changed` fires and the live map swaps tiles, then
re-clears the just-rewritten localStorage entry.
## What is explicitly preserved (per issue body)
- `meshcore-theme` — separate user preference, not a customization
- `meshcore-gesture-hints-*` — has its own dedicated Reset button
- `meshcore-favorites` — operator's favorites list, not a customizer
pick
- `mc-channels-*` — channel selection state, not a customization

## Why CI was failing on master
PR #1493 (BYOP modal fix for #1487) shipped an E2E test that runs at
BOTH 390×844 mobile + 1280×800 desktop. The test calls
`waitForSelector('[data-action=pkt-byop]')` which defaults to `state:
visible`.
But #1471 mobile UX rules explicitly hide BYOP on mobile:
`#pktLeft .page-header [data-action="pkt-byop"] { display: none
!important }`
So the test times out on the mobile pass, breaking master CI on every
commit since c841dbcc.
## Fix
Drop the mobile viewport from the test loop. Reporter (@EldoonNemar)'s
bug was on desktop — that's where we test.
If BYOP ever gets surfaced on mobile, re-enable the mobile pass.

## Summary
Fixes#1486 — clicking the collapse chevron on a grouped packet row in
the packets table no longer reopens the detail panel that the operator
just closed.
## Root cause
In the `#pktBody` row click handler the `toggle-select` action ran
**both** `pktToggleGroup(value)` and `pktSelectHash(value)` on every
chevron click. `pktToggleGroup()` already opens the detail panel itself
(via `selectPacket()`) when it expands a row, so the trailing
`pktSelectHash()` was:
- redundant on **expand** (the panel was already opening), and
- harmful on **collapse** — after the operator closed the detail panel
via the ✕ in `#pktRight`, clicking the same chevron a second time
to collapse the tree re-fetched `/packets/<hash>` and re-populated
the panel with the same packet, exactly the behavior the issue
describes.
## Fix
Drop the unconditional `pktSelectHash(value)` call inside the
`toggle-select` branch. `pktToggleGroup()` already handles the
expand-side panel open; the collapse branch does no panel work, so a
closed panel stays closed.
```js
else if (action === 'toggle-select') {
// #1486: pktToggleGroup() already opens the detail panel on EXPAND
// (via selectPacket()), and must NOT open it on COLLAPSE.
pktToggleGroup(value);
}
```
## Tests
- New Playwright E2E `test-issue-1486-collapse-reopens-detail-e2e.js`
walks the operator-visible repro: expand → assert panel open →
click ✕ → assert panel empty → click chevron again → assert row
collapsed AND panel STILL empty.
- Committed red-first: the test was added in its own commit and FAILS
on the unpatched code (3 passed / 1 failed), then GREEN on the fix
commit (4 passed / 0 failed).
- CI workflow seeds two extra observations onto the newest fixture
transmission so a grouped (`toggle-select`) row exists; without this
the fixture renders only flat rows and the chevron can't be
exercised.
## Reproduction (manual, against staging or local)
1. Open `/#/packets` on desktop.
2. Click a grouped row's `▶` chevron — the tree expands and the detail
panel opens on the right.
3. Click the `✕` in the top-right of the detail panel — panel goes back
to "Select a packet to view details".
4. Click the same chevron (now `▼`) again — **before:** detail panel
reopens with the same packet. **After:** the row collapses and the
panel stays empty.

## Summary
Animations on the live map (packet pulses, hop-to-hop trails,
drawAnimatedLine, pulseNode rings, matrix chars) render BEHIND the node
base layer — community-confirmed by @EldoonNemar in #1485 after pulling
latest and rebuilding. The live map looks completely static because
every node marker paints on top of moving packets.
Closes#1485
## Root cause
PR #1334 ("role-aware marker shapes + outline-ring highlight") swapped
node markers:
- **Before:** `L.circleMarker([n.lat, n.lon], {...})` — rendered into
the default Leaflet `overlayPane` (z=400) alongside other vector shapes.
- **After:** `L.marker([n.lat, n.lon], { icon: L.divIcon({...}) })` —
rendered into the default Leaflet `markerPane` (z=600).
`animLayer` and `pathsLayer` (built from `L.polyline` / `L.circleMarker`
shapes) still default to `overlayPane` @ 400. With nodes now in pane
600, every node marker occluded every animation. CDP confirmed pre-fix:
```
overlayPane z=400 (animations live here) ← 2 children
markerPane z=600 (nodes live here) ← 516 children ← occludes
```
## Fix
Create a custom Leaflet pane `liveAnimPane` at `z-index: 650` (strictly
above markerPane) and pin both `animLayer` and `pathsLayer` to it via
the `{ pane: 'liveAnimPane' }` option on `L.layerGroup`. Polylines +
circleMarkers added to those groups inherit the pane from their parent,
so all `drawAnimatedLine` / `pulseNode` / `animatePath` / matrix-char
shapes now paint above markers.
`pointerEvents: 'none'` on the pane so it does not steal hover/click
events from the markerPane beneath (`clickablePathsLayer` keeps the
default overlayPane and continues to handle path clicks).
Diff is +14 / -2 in `public/live.js`. No CSS changes, no API changes, no
protocol changes.

## Summary
Reporter (@EldoonNemar in #1488) found the new white marker stroke
overwhelming with hundreds of nodes on screen. This PR exposes the
stroke through CSS vars + a customizer panel so operators can dial
color/width/opacity (or remove it) without code edits.
**Scope:** ship stroke customization only. The reporter also asked for
the old glow-style highlight ring as an alternative — that's a separate
visual feature that needs design discussion, so it's deferred to a
follow-up issue.
## Changes
- **`public/style.css`** `:root` declares `--mc-marker-stroke-color` /
`--mc-marker-stroke-width` / `--mc-marker-stroke-opacity` with sensible
defaults (white, 1, 1) that match current behavior.
- **`public/roles.js`** `makeRoleMarkerSVG` — replaced the 6 baked
`stroke="#fff" stroke-width="1"` literals with a single shared
`strokeAttr` referencing the CSS vars. One source of truth for all role
shapes.
- **`public/map.js`** `makeMarkerIcon` — same migration. The observer
star overlay keeps its narrow 0.8 width but routes color + opacity
through the same vars.
- **`public/live.js`** `addNodeMarker` fallback SVG — same migration.
- **`public/customize-v2.js`** — new `markerStroke` object section
(color/width/opacity) with validation, `applyCSS` writes, three controls
on the Colors tab → "Marker Stroke" panel (color picker + width slider
0–4 + opacity slider 0–100%). Optimistic CSS-var writes on the `input`
event so markers repaint live as the operator drags.
- **`cmd/server/{config,types,routes}.go`** — `ThemeFile` / `Config` /
`ThemeResponse` pick up `MarkerStroke` so `theme.json` and `config.json`
can ship server-side defaults. Defaults mirror the `:root` CSS values so
no breaking change for current operators.
- **`config.example.json`** — documented `markerStroke` section with
usage hint.

## What
Three of the four P0s from #1481's scale-test findings. Each cuts a
distinct
hot path; together they target /api/observers,
/api/analytics/neighbor-graph,
and /api/observers/{id}/analytics — the top three live offenders.
### P0-1: 5-min atomic-pointer cache for default neighbor-graph response
- Live p95 10.8s on the most-trafficked organic endpoint.
- Background recomputer (5-min cadence per operator directive) builds
the
default-filter (`minCount=5 minScore=0.1`, no region, no role)
`NeighborGraphResponse` and stores it via `atomic.Pointer`.
- `handleNeighborGraph` short-circuits on the default shape; non-default
filters take the extracted `computeNeighborGraphResponse` path
(identical
semantics to the previous inline build).
### P0-2: cache parsed `StoreObs.Timestamp` + drop RLock window
- `handleObserverAnalytics` re-parsed the RFC3339 timestamp three times
per observation, for 60k+ observations per active observer, under
`s.store.mu.RLock` — blocking writers for the full scan.
- `StoreObs.ParsedTime()` parses once via `sync.Once` (mirrors
`StoreTx.ParsedDecoded`).
- Handler snapshots the `byObserver[id]` pointer slice, releases the
RLock immediately, then iterates locally.
### P0-3: 30s cache for `/api/observers` + sargable `IN` + covering
index
- Three SQL queries on every request → ~1.7s p50 at 50-concurrent.
- Atomic-pointer 30s cache for the default (no-filter) query.
- `GetNodeLocationsByKeys` drops `LOWER(public_key) IN (...)`
(non-sargable);
callers pre-lowercase in Go and the plain `IN` matches the existing
`public_key` index.
- New ingestor migration `obs_observer_ts_idx_v1` adds composite index
`idx_observations_observer_idx_timestamp(observer_idx, timestamp)` so
`GetObserverPacketCounts` can resolve its GROUP-BY + range filter from
the index without scanning the 1.9M-row observations table.
### P0-4: deferred
`perfMiddleware`'s global mutex was claimed to serialize every API
request.
A direct test (`50 concurrent requests through the middleware, handler
sleeps 20ms each`) shows total elapsed ≈ 25ms, not 1s — the lock is held
only for the post-handler bookkeeping (a few µs). Real impact is below
measurement noise. Skipping to avoid invasive churn on PerfStats
consumers
without a demonstrable win.

## Default-filter detection vs frontend reality (#1483 follow-up)
The Neighbor Graph analytics tab in `public/analytics.js` fetches
`/analytics/neighbor-graph?min_count=1&min_score=0` because the
client-side sliders need the full edge set to filter from. That shape
did NOT match the `(5, 0.1)` cached default, so the UI tab still paid
the cold compute cost despite #1481 P0-1.
The #1483 follow-up commit caches BOTH shapes in the same recomputer
pass:
- `(minCount=5, minScore=0.1, no region, no role)` — `live.js`
affinity-scoring consumer.
- `(minCount=1, minScore=0, no region, no role)` — analytics tab.
Both are served from `atomic.Pointer` with an `X-Cache-Age-Seconds`
header. The per-shape cost in the background goroutine is roughly
linear in edge count; total recompute time stays well under the
5-minute cadence on prod-scale graphs.
